BSN Completion Program
The BSN Completion program at University of Wyoming is not a licensure or certification preparation program. Before the BSN degree is conferred through this option, the student is required to have an associate’s degree in Nursing, which has prepared them for licensure as a Registered Nurse (RN) prior to application. A student may also already hold a current RN license prior to application to the BSN Completion program. Completing this program will not in any way lead or guarantee a student to licensure/certification or employment.
